Fix TileMapLayer bug where dirty cells could be marked twice

When using runtime data in a TileMapLayer, calling notify_runtime_tile_update
can cause error messages to be printed to the console if the same cell has been
set or erased in the same frame. This could be partially worked around by using
call_deferred on notify_runtime_tile_update, but the problem could re-emerge if
those updates were being made in coroutines.

This commit addresses the issue by adding an additional check to the dirty cell
marking of the TileMapLayer when notify_runtime_tile_update is called. This
check ensures that the cell has not already been added to the dirty cell list,
preventing the condition that causes the error message.
